What is an Ergonomic Rollator Walker?
An ergonomic rollator walker is a mobility aid designed to assist people with walking difficulties. Unlike traditional walkers, rollators offer additional features like wheels, a brake system, and seats, enabling users to browse their environments more effectively and conveniently. The ergonomic aspects of these walkers focus on reducing stress on the body and improving user experience.

The benefits of using an ergonomic rollator walker extend far beyond basic mobility. Here are several advantages that can profoundly affect the quality of life for users:

Improved Stability and Safety: The design of ergonomic rollators lowers the danger of falls, supplying users with a secure and stable walking experience.

Improved Mobility: With the aid of wheels, users can browse effortlessly through different surfaces, including irregular surfaces, which might pose challenges for standard walkers.

Increased Comfort: Features such as padded deals with and seats aid reduce stress on the hands and body, enabling for more extended usage without discomfort.

Flexible Use: Rollator walkers can serve numerous functions, from offering support while walking to offering a place to sit down when required.

Encouraging Independence: The enhanced functionality and comfort permit users to retain a degree of self-reliance, empowering them to engage more actively in everyday activities.

Selecting the proper rollator walker depends upon various aspects. Here are some ideas to think about when making your decision:

Height Adjustment: Ensure the walker can be changed to suit your height for ideal posture.

Weight Capacity: Check the maximum weight limitation, specifically if you need a heavy-duty design.

Comfort Features: Assess the padding on deals with and seats and consider additional features such as backrests.

Maneuverability: Look for a design that suits your living area and daily activities.

Storage Options: Consider if a basket or pouch is helpful for your needs during trips.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Do I require a prescription to buy an ergonomic rollator walker?
No, a prescription is not usually needed. Nevertheless, it is recommended to consult a health care specialist for suggestions based on individual requirements.
2. How do I preserve my rollator walker?
Routine look for loose screws, cleaning the wheels, and inspecting the brake system are necessary for preserving your walker's efficiency. Follow the producer's guidelines for any particular maintenance suggestions.
3. Can I use a rollator walker outdoors?
Yes, ergonomic rollator walkers are designed for both indoor and outdoor usage. Ensure you choose one with suitable wheels for the surface areas you frequent.
4. How do I change the deals with effectively?
To change the manages, stand with your arms at your sides. The handles ought to be at wrist level when your elbows are a little bent. Adjust as essential to accomplish this height.
5. Are there any negative effects of using a rollator walker?
While rollator walkers are normally safe, inappropriate use or using a walker that doesn't fit correctly can result in pressure or pain in the arms or back. It's essential to follow usage guidelines and consult health care providers if discomfort takes place.
